Chapter 19: A Strange Lady
***
“Here, please have some tea.”
In the spacious reception hall, the Duchess personally brought over fine Earl Grey tea, gently placing it before Carlos and me.
“Oh, thank you.” Carlos picked up the exquisitely crafted teacup, properly held it to his nose for a gentle sniff, then took a small sip, “Very fragrant indeed, it’s been a long time since I’ve had such good red tea, Madam’s skill is as excellent as ever.”
“You’re too kind, Sir Carlos.” The Duchess covered her mouth with a light laugh while casually pulling out the chair next to mine and sitting down.
Immediately, a subtle elegant fragrance filled my nostrils, the kind of scent that belonged to a mature woman, which somehow gave me a faint sense of comfort as I breathed it in.
I secretly turned my face to look at the woman who was now within arm’s reach, still in her prime years. Her delicate features weren’t heavily made up, and like mine, her silk-like black hair was pinned high on her head. The skin exposed at her neck was as smooth as congealed cream, and every gesture carried the refinement of high society.
Too beautiful!
I was secretly amazed. Earlier in the study, my attention had been focused on Lord Scalliger, and only now did I realize that this was the first true beauty I’d seen since coming to this world.
Unlike those weathered common women who had no time to care for themselves, her beauty could truly be described as breathtaking. And for some reason, the Duchess’s appearance seemed familiar to me, with an intuition that I must have seen her somewhere before.
At this moment, the Duchess was having an animated conversation with Carlos, but I hadn’t heard a single word they said, continuously wracking my brain trying to remember where I might have seen this Duchess.
Although I knew it was absurd.
How long had I been in this world, and I’d only just arrived in Winter City today, how could I possibly have seen this lady before? But the sense of deja vu was too strong, so strong that I even felt I should be quite familiar with her.
What’s going on?
Since today, my thoughts had been very confused. The verification of the earlier hallucination, what the cake shop girl had said, and… this inexplicable feeling after arriving at Shanter Castle.
All of this seemed to point in some direction in the grand scheme of things.
“…Miss Sylvia, what’s wrong? You look so worried, is the tea not to your liking?”
The Duchess’s words interrupted my thoughts, and I suddenly looked up to find that she and Carlos had stopped talking at some point, both looking at me with puzzled expressions.
“Ah, no. I was… thinking about something.”
To prevent the Duchess from thinking I didn’t like her tea, I quickly picked up the teacup and tilted my head back, drinking the full cup in one go.
…So hot!!!
“Cough cough!”
The scalding tea nearly brought tears to my eyes, my mouth burning fiercely. I quickly stuck out my tongue, panting like a little pug dog, while my right hand vigorously fanned cool air toward my mouth, trying to quickly reduce the temperature of my tongue.
“Hahaha!”
Carlos very ungracefully pointed and laughed at me, and even the Duchess couldn’t help but show an amused smile at my appearance.
I understood I’d embarrassed myself again, wanted to get angry but knew it wasn’t the right situation, so I could only sullenly glare at Carlos to vent my frustration.
“Look at you, how can you be so careless.”
The Duchess’s gentle voice came from beside me, and I saw her pick up her sleeve and reach toward my mouth, making to wipe away the water on my lips.
I was stunned.
This gesture caught me off guard, feeling the cool yet delicate touch on my lips, I looked at her somewhat dumbfounded, not knowing how to react for a moment.
Although I had an inexplicable sense of familiarity with her, she was still the Duchess after all, and since this was our first meeting, such an intimate gesture made me uncomfortable and seemed inappropriate. Even Carlos, who witnessed this scene, showed a deeply surprised expression.
But the Duchess did it very naturally, and she herself didn’t seem to notice anything improper, just looking at me tenderly, gently wiping me clean before finally noticing my slightly shocked expression, and somewhat awkwardly lowered her arm.
“Ah, I apologize, that was rude of me. It’s just that Miss Sylvia is so adorable… You didn’t hurt your mouth, did you?”
“Madam, I’m fine.”
I shook my head at her, wanting to say more but not knowing how to begin.
It felt like both the Duke and Duchess’s attitudes toward me were really puzzling, giving me the feeling that they wanted to confirm something from me.
Carlos also seemed to have noticed something, frowning silently.
The atmosphere became somewhat silent for a moment.
Fortunately, the butler arrived timely with a plate of donuts.
“Dear guests, these refreshments are made by the Duchess herself, please enjoy.”
…Dessert!
It looks so delicious!
I looked at the sweet and soft donuts carefully arranged on the plate, my appetite was aroused, and my eyes couldn’t move away.
“I didn’t know Madam could make these,” Carlos said with some amazement.
“It’s just a personal hobby, when I have nothing to do, I like to experiment with these things. After all, we used to have a little glutton at home who loved sweets…”
Is there some etiquette to this? Should the host make some gesture first before we as guests can start eating? Would it be okay if I eat one now?
How should I do this, just grab it with my hands?
Will Carlos laugh at me?
If he dares to laugh, I’ll curse him to be single forever, never finding a wife!
While I was internally mumbling these thoughts, the Duchess had already brought a donut to my mouth.
“Miss Sylvia, try my handiwork, how is it?”
Hearing the Duchess’s words, I immediately turned my head, and then saw her face trying hard to hold back a smile, immediately understanding that my thoughts had been seen through, so I simply stopped pretending and gracefully accepted the donut, eagerly taking a bite.
The donut had a creamy texture, with a lasting flavor, and after a few chews, my eyes lit up.
“Thish ish, sho good!”
“Swallow your food before speaking.”
Carlos seemed somewhat dissatisfied with my behavior, but at this moment I had no mood to argue with him.
After all, this donut was really too delicious, so delicious that it made my heart ache, and very embarrassingly, I felt the urge to cry.
“Madam, this is super delicious!” I said excitedly with a flushed face to the Duchess beside me.
“It has a name, you know, it’s called Captain Grey.”
Hearing the Duchess’s words, I tilted my head.
“Captain Grey?”
A donut named captain?
Why? How strange. Why give it such a name?
But that’s not important, as long as it’s delicious.
I’ve decided, Captain Grey, you’re ranked number one in deliciousness in my heart!
“Captain Grey, I like it.”
I smiled sweetly at the Duchess.
“If you like it, shall I make it for you every day?”
The Duchess’s eyes were like stars in the night sky, shining with strange excitement. She looked at me with a kind expression.
Then she started crying.
…Eh?
My expression froze as I watched the Duchess tightly covering her mouth, trying hard not to make a sound, not knowing what to do for a moment.
What’s going on all of a sudden?
I just complimented your donuts for being delicious, do you need to be this moved… this is really difficult for me.
Not only was I confused, but Carlos also showed a puzzled expression at the situation before him.
“Madam, what’s wrong?”
“I’m fine… just, remembered… some sad memories from the past.”
The Duchess’s emotional outburst was just a momentary thing, like something that had been suppressed for a long time suddenly bursting forth, this feeling came quickly and went quickly, and she soon contained her emotions.
“I’m sorry, as one gets older, one becomes more sentimental, I’ve made you laugh at me.”
“Madam, what are you saying, you don’t look old at all,” Carlos had to say some flattering words to liven up the atmosphere.
“I’m already 46 years old, with three children.”
46 years old!
I was so surprised I couldn’t speak, but she looked like she was just in her early thirties. It’s really hard to believe, how does she maintain herself?
Because I was too shocked internally, I decided to eat another Captain Grey to calm down.
“Smack.”
The little hand secretly reaching for the plate was slapped away, I was startled, then anger welled up in my heart, and I immediately raised my head to glare back at Carlos’s wide eyes.
“Don’t bring shame to the Pontifical Knights.”
Carlos said calmly.
“Mind your own business!”
I shouted back defiantly, no longer caring about maintaining any image at this point.
It’s really infuriating, I just want to eat a donut, what’s wrong with that? How does it affect you?
“Come now, Sir Carlos. Really now, why are you bullying a young girl?” the Duchess said with a smile.
“Exactly.”
I immediately followed up on the Duchess’s words, then as if in revenge, grabbed two donuts and desperately stuffed them into my mouth, one in each hand.
Carlos was immediately at a loss for words.
Just then, a loud noise came from beside my ear as the reception hall’s large door was suddenly pushed open.
A young man about 20 years old burst in, and upon seeing the Duchess, shouted loudly: “Mom, where’s my sister!? Is she back?”
“Quiet! Parsifal, we have guests here.” The Duchess frowned with displeasure.
“Where’s my sister?” The man didn’t heed the Duchess’s words, stood there looking around, then saw me with my cheeks stuffed full of food, looking bewildered.
“Pe… Peylo?”
